Memorial Healthcare recently received a donation to The Cancer Center from the Byron Volleyball team on Monday, Nov. 14. The freshmen, Junior Varsity and Varsity teams celebrated the moment with a meal and a tour through the facility for their sizeable $4,000 donation to the cancer center. The Byron volleyball teams raised the money by selling 2,400 volleyballs, all for a donation of $1 or more during their season. Players wore shirts during the season dedicated to someone they knew who had either survived cancer or were undergoing treatment.
On hand were staff from the Memorial Healthcare Cancer Center, as well as patients and three cancer survivors. Dr. Mahmood spoke to the team, saying, “This was very thoughtful of them, especially in this day and age. The money will be put to good use.”
